George Swisher was born in Guilford, North Carolina, USA in 1799, to Johann (John) Swisher and Magdalena Tickle. Later in life, George Swisher married Elizabeth Bassett, Catherine Moss and Cathrine Goodner\Coodner; among their children were Caroline Swisher, Jesse Swisher, William Swisher, Salina J. Swisher, Mary Elizabeth Swisher, Martha Swisher, John M. Swisher, George Washington Swisher, Walter George Swisher, Polly A Swisher, Margaret A Swisher, Katharine Swisher and Phebe Swisher. George Swisher died in Vermilion County, Illinois, USA, 1852.
